Frequently Asked Questions About Virtual Office Backgrounds
What is a virtual office background?
A virtual office background is a digital image displayed behind you during a video call, replacing your real physical environment. Used on platforms like Zoom, Microsoft Teams, and Google Meet, virtual backgrounds help professionals create a polished, distraction-free appearance regardless of their physical location. They're particularly popular among remote workers, freelancers, and distributed teams who want to maintain a consistent and professional presence on every call.
Which virtual backgrounds work best for Zoom, Teams, and Google Meet?
The best virtual backgrounds work across all three platforms — the key is using a high-resolution image (1920 × 1080px) in JPG or PNG format, which renders cleanly in Zoom, Microsoft Teams, and Google Meet alike. That said, each platform handles background removal slightly differently: Zoom tends to produce the sharpest edge detection, while Teams and Google Meet perform best with good front lighting and a contrasting background. All backgrounds available at Custom Virtual Office are optimized for use across all major video conferencing platforms.
What image size should I use for a virtual office background?
The recommended size for a virtual office background is 1920 × 1080 pixels with a 16:9 aspect ratio. Most platforms support JPG, PNG, and BMP file formats, with a maximum file size of 5MB. Using the correct dimensions prevents cropping, pixelation, and poor blending with the platform's background removal effect — especially important if you're not using a physical green screen.

Do I need a green screen to use a virtual background?
No — a green screen is not required to use a virtual background on Zoom, Microsoft Teams, or Google Meet. All three platforms use AI-powered background removal that works without any additional hardware. For the best results without a green screen, use good front-facing lighting, wear clothing that contrasts with your background, and choose a plain or lightly textured wall behind you. A green screen can improve edge sharpness if you're on older hardware or in a challenging lighting environment, but it's entirely optional for most users.
Tips For Choosing The Best Office Background for You
With so many choices, how do you pick the right one? Here are a few tips to help narrow it down:
Match Your Industry
A sleek boardroom may suit a financial consultant, while a creative might prefer an art-inspired home office.
Consider Your Role
If you’re frequently on sales calls or running webinars, a branded or client-facing background might work best.
Think About Lighting
Avoid overly dark backgrounds if your lighting setup is limited. Opt for something that complements your real lighting conditions.
Use Your Brand Colors
Where appropriate, include your brand’s palette or logo to stay on-brand—especially for team-wide usage.
Test for Distractions
Make sure the background isn’t too “busy” or animated. The goal is to enhance your presence, not compete with it.
Mind the Blur
If you don’t use green screens, some virtual backgrounds can glitch. Stick with designs optimized for software like Zoom, Microsoft Teams, or Google Meet.
